Does the fact that two of David DePape’s webpages were not archived in the Internet Wayback Machine until after the attack on Paul Pelosi prove they were “fabricated” after the suspect’s arrest to smear conservatives? No, that’s not true: The webpages attributed to DePape were so small and obscure that they would likely not be archived in that database without someone submitting them, according to a spokesman for Archive.org. The pages were archived hours after police named David DePape as the person arrested for attacking House Speaker Nancy Pelosi’s husband. Archive.org “patrons” manually used the “save this now” feature, the spokesman told Lead Stories, which saved a copy in case the original was taken down. The Wayback Machine doesn’t automatically archive every page on the web.
